IAV Automotive Engineering seeks Control Systems Engineer Level 3 in Novi, MI.
Job Duties: Review system requirements with the customer (internal & external). Support the definition of subsystem requirements for components, e.g., energy storage, electric motor, power electronics, charging systems. Execute drive cycle-based energy analysis using math-based models. Define and analyze powertrain architectures used in PHEV and HEV applications. Support the design and implementation of algorithms and functions based on requirements. Participate in function and SW code reviews. Create function description documentation. Support validation test plan creation. Execute software validation test plans. Review test case results.
